From 066e210e0749525d632d36f40b32e69ff055b17b Mon Sep 17 00:00:00 2001 From: GitLab Bot Date: Thu, 14 Apr 2022 21:09:21 +0000 Subject: Add latest changes from gitlab-org/gitlab@master --- .../sidebars/groups/menus/group_information_menu_spec.rb | 14 ++++++++++++++ 1 file changed, 14 insertions(+) (limited to 'spec/lib/sidebars') diff --git a/spec/lib/sidebars/groups/menus/group_information_menu_spec.rb b/spec/lib/sidebars/groups/menus/group_information_menu_spec.rb index b68af6fb8ab..5f67ee11970 100644 --- a/spec/lib/sidebars/groups/menus/group_information_menu_spec.rb +++ b/spec/lib/sidebars/groups/menus/group_information_menu_spec.rb @@ -28,6 +28,20 @@ RSpec.describe Sidebars::Groups::Menus::GroupInformationMenu do end end + describe '#sprite_icon' do + subject { described_class.new(context).sprite_icon } + + context 'when group is a root group' do + specify { is_expected.to eq 'group'} + end + + context 'when group is a child group' do + let(:group) { build(:group, parent: root_group) } + + specify { is_expected.to eq 'subgroup'} + end + end + describe 'Menu Items' do subject { described_class.new(context).renderable_items.index { |e| e.item_id == item_id } } -- cgit v1.2.3